Gyudon Beef Rice Bowl

Gyudon Beef Rice Bowl is Japanese home cooking, eaten at lunch and dinner. On the plate it is the dish at the centre. Below is what usually sits beside it, what it does and does not contain, and what else to cook once you have made it.

20 min Easy Dairy free

Ingredients

  • 1.25 lb thinly sliced beef
  • 1 onion
  • 1 cup dashi stock
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p sugar
  • 1 tbsp grated ginger
  • 5 cups cooked white rice
  • 3 scallions

How to cook it

  1. Bring the dashi, soy sauce, sugar, and ginger to a simmer in a skillet.
  2. Add the sliced onion and cook until translucent, about 5 minutes.
  3. Add the thinly sliced beef and simmer, separating the pieces, until cooked through, about 5 minutes.
  4. Let the beef soak up the sauce for a couple of minutes off direct heat.
  5. Spoon the beef and onion over bowls of warm rice with some of the broth.
  6. Top with scallions and serve.

Safe at your table

Dinejot tracks ten allergens and tags every one of them by hand, so the absences below are as deliberate as the presences. Gyudon Beef Rice Bowl carries gluten, soy, and fish. It is free of the remaining 7 allergens on that list.
